Absolutely loved this spot! The décor and overall ambiance are very welcoming, and the employees were thoughtful and genuinely helpful. I’m a bit picky with my coffee, and they definitely went above and beyond to help me choose something to try. If this matters to you, all of their drinks are made from a cold brew concentrate...no espresso shots are used here.
To be completely honest, the coffee wasn’t my favorite and probably not something I’d order again, but that’s purely personal preference. I’ll definitely be back to try a matcha or a tea! The baked goods, along with popping in for a quick chat with the employees, make this place worth stopping by.
